AWNING BAR AND PROJECTOR SYSTEM
An awning bar includes an awning bar body, the awning bar body having a length extending between a first end and a second end. The awning bar further includes at least one power track extending along the awning bar body. The power track includes at least one magnet configured to provide magnetic attachment to the power track and provide power to an accessory upon contact with the power track. An awning bar kit includes an awning bar and at least one awning bar accessory. An awning bar system includes an awning bar and at least one arm attachable to the awning bar. The arm is configured to move the awning bar away and towards a vertical wall.
AWNING PROJECTOR SYSTEM
A projector system including an awning bar having an awning bar body having a length extending between a first end and a second end. The projector system includes a projector having a projection lens. The projector is attachable to the awning bar along the length. The awning bar is configured to attach to a portion of an awning canopy such that the projection lens is located below the awning canopy when the awning canopy is in an open position.
RESIDENTIAL AWNING CANOPY ASSEMBLY
An awning is disclosed. The awning comprises a case assembly comprising a housing, configured to be mounted to a dwelling, and a lead rail, a roller assembly mounted in the case assembly and including a roll tube rotatable relative to the case assembly, a lead rail assembly coupled to the lead rail, the lead rail assembly movable relative to the housing between an extended position and a retracted position, a canopy having a leading edge and a trailing edge, the leading edge being connected to the lead rail assembly and the trailing edge being connected to the roll tube, and a spring arm assembly connecting the housing of the case assembly to the lead rail, the spring arms including a first arm and a second arm pivotable relative to one another, the spring arm assembly allowing the lead rail assembly to move between the extended position and the retracted position.

RETRACTABLE AWNING ASSEMBLIES AND METHODS FOR PACKAGING THE SAME
The present disclosure describes a retractable awning assembly. The retractable awning assembly may include a plurality of roller tube sections, at least two torsion bar sections, a pair of spring-loaded arms, a fabric cover, a plurality of front bar sections, a pair of end caps, a plurality of mounting brackets, and a plurality of hood sections. Methods of assembling the same are provided.
Awning Assembly
The present embodiments are directed to an awning assembly 1 for a recreational vehicle comprising a main body, a flexible awning material, a roller tube, a lead rail 5, at least one support leg 6 hinged to the lead rail 5, and at least one tension rafter 7 being mountable between the main body and the lead rail 5. The at least one support leg 6 is hinged to the lead rail 5 so that the support leg 6 can be hinged into a first storage section of the lead rail frame 8. The lead rail frame 8 comprises a second storage section 10 for receiving the tension rafter 7 therein, wherein the second storage section 10 comprises an opening 11, wherein either holder 12 is disposed within the opening 11, or the tension rafter 7 is self-clamping into the second storage section 10.

ADJUSTABLE AWNING
An adjustable awning has no longitudinal linkage, which makes efficient use of space, can be assembled with a collapsible roof as a whole, increasing the function of the collapsible roof, and can be unfolded together with the collapsible roof, controlled by a mechanism inside the collapsible roof, and the control mechanism can be adjusted to select whether the awning is linked to the roof or not. The horizontal adjustable awning includes an internal control mechanism, a main transmission mechanism and a folding mechanism. The internal control mechanism includes a spring roller, a drive belt, a belt end block and a block snap; the main transmission mechanism includes a pulley, a filament rod, a shade cloth mechanism, a bearing housing, a rack and pinion mechanism and a gear housing; the folding mechanism includes two rotating pushers, two articulated sliders and a protective plate.
